Taarzan: The Wonder Car is a 2004 romantic thriller film directed by Abbas Burmawalla and Mustan Burmawalla. The film stars Vatsal Seth, Ajay Devgn and Ayesha Takia in the lead roles, while Farida Jalal, Shakti Kapoor, Amrish Puri, Pankaj Dheer, Sadashiv Amrapurkar, Gulshan Grover and Mukesh Tiwari play supporting roles. The film is inspired by the 1983 horror, Christine.

The films tells the story of an un-named Indian Muslim, who helps illegal refugees from both India and Pakistan to cross the border through the Great Rann of Kutch. The film is attributed to have been inspired by the short story "Love Across the Salt Desert" by Keki N. Daruwalla.
